tc, they eat just about anything!  I was trying to post a picture of our Resident RR "preparing" his meal of a baby gopher snake in my front yard.  (I do wish he'd leave the baby gophers snakes alone as they keep the rattler and gopher population down.)  So far, I know that he's snacked on the snake, a good number of lizards, the 3 Kill Deer eggs, 5 baby birds in a nest I thought were well hidden, and an unknown number of sparrow & mocking bird eggs in the Italian Cypress trees.  He DIVES into those trees!
